Really cool layout with dorms being in separate huts arranged around the pool and bar in the middle, music playing. Friendly atmosphere but could do with some activities in the evenings. Only downside was the staff on reception, they were quite rude towards guests. Also kitchen full of insects, constantly getting flies and ants in my food! $20 deposit for a mug and cutlery. Internet is $4 for an hour on a computer or for 24h wifi.

This hostel is a mixed bag. The dorm rooms are spacious and air conditioned, have 2 showers and a toilet (though you can hear almost anything from in there). Rooms were pretty clean. Now to the downsides: staff ranged from pretty unhelpful to downright rude, if you don't like people don't work at the reception. The hostel is probably too large, we got food stolen from the fridge and it seems to be common. You have to pay everything extra like lockers, wifi, 20$ deposit for cutlery.
